To analyze complex auto bodily injury claims on behalf of our valued clients by evaluating coverage, investigating liability, and managing damages, while ensuring timely resolution within service expectations, industry best practices, and specific client requirements. 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BLITIES MAY INCLUDE Processes complex auto commercial and personal line claims, including bodily injury and ensures claim files are properly documented and coded correctly. Responsible for litigation process on litigated claims. Coordinates vendor management, including the use of independent adjusters to assist the investigation of claims. Reports large claims to excess carrier(s). Develops and maintains action plans to ensure state required contact deadlines are met and to move the file towards prompt and appropriate resolution. Identifies and pursues subrogation and risk transfer opportunities; secures and disposes of salvage. Communicates claim action/processing with insured, client, and agent or broker when appropriate.
